Practical Nurse Program Overview
STI offers full-time day and part-time evening Practical Nurse Programs that prepare the graduate to be eligible to apply to take the NCLEX-PN examination.
The course of study includes classroom, laboratory and clinical learning experiences. Candidates should be highly motivated and energetic, seeking to enter the demanding field of nursing.

Licensure & State Eligibility Information
Graduates from the STI Practical Nurse Program are qualified to work in the state of Massachusetts upon the successful attainment of the appropriate licensure. Not all states accept a Massachusetts license. If you intend to practice outside of Massachusetts and obtain a license in another state, you are encouraged to review the NCSBN website for eligibility. As an applicant to the STI Practical Nurse Program, you are encouraged to discuss your ability for licensure and work in another state other than Massachusetts with the Practical Nurse Program Director.
The entry-level graduate of Southeastern Technical Institute is expected to:

Utilize critical thinking within the framework of the nursing process as a basis for nursing practice.
Execute effective communication with patients, families and members of the health care team.
Apply knowledge of the physical, behavioral and social sciences while providing therapeutic nursing care.
Implement safe therapeutic nursing care.
Participate in nursing decisions consistent with standards and scope of LPN practice.
Utilize holistic care as a member of the health care team.
Establish goals consistent with the principles of life-long learning.
